AI Technical Summary
During high-power laser cutting, the cutting head lens deforms due to high temperature, causing focal length shift and resulting in inconsistent cross-sectional effects when cutting large contour parts.
By automatically generating a focus compensation data table, focus compensation is performed based on the opening time, including axis focus compensation and pre-focus compensation. The focal axis is adjusted to eliminate focus shift caused by lens deformation, thereby achieving consistent cutting results.
A convenient and efficient focus compensation method is provided, which eliminates lens deformation caused by high temperature and significantly improves the consistency of cutting effect.
